All Elite Wrestling could be on the verge of landing the big beefy bruiser its active roster currently lacks, with Sports Illustrated's Justin Barrasso reporting that the promotion is in "high-level talks" to sign Lance Archer of NJPW.

2019 saw Archer emerge as one of New Japan's surprise packages as he played a starring role in the G1 Climax tournament, then enjoyed a short IWGP North American Championship reign before dropping the strap to Jon Moxley at Wrestle Kingdom 14. He's a relatively prominent, pushed commodity, but not under contract with the promotion - hence why he'd be able to negotiate with AEW.

Archer is one of (and probably the) best working big man in wrestling today. A 6'8" giant with an imposing aura, awesome power game, and the agility and balance to execute flawless rope-walks and dives like a man half his size, he has become one of the most eye-catching wrestlers in the world. He'd be an immediate boon to AEW, or any other promotion for that matter.

With Brian Cage rumoured to be on the way, Wardlow finally stepping into the ring, and now Archer, AEW's roster could be about to get a lot beefier.
